Hello Bo YU,

>The package can be built on riscv64 arch and this is tested on my
>local real riscv64 machines.

the package can even be built on big endian architectures, but it
won’t work right there at the moment.

The current situation is that we have to use upstream’s build for
the embedded Opus library, which is whitelisted *only* on the four
architectures listed.

>It looks like this package is currently an abandoned package which can
>be updated with QA upload for the next upload.

In theory it could, but DO NOT do that.
Please look at debian/control which says:

# will be "any" once #686777 is fixed
# armel might work but better safe than crash
Architecture: amd64 arm64 armhf i386

Once we have these Opus functions, we can switch the package to
use the system library and then the weird build for the embedded
opus lib can go away and THEN we can add more architectures.
